What is the standard form of y= (3x-4)^2+(8x-2)^2 ?

73x^2 - 56x + 20

Explanation:

standard form means expanding the brackets and collecting like terms in descending order.

(3x -4 )^2 + (8x - 2 )^2

= (3x - 4 )(3x - 4 ) + (8x - 2 )(8x - 2 )

= 3x(3x - 4 ) -4(3x - 4 ) + 8x(8x - 2 ) -2(8x - 2 )

= 9x^2 - 12x - 12x + 16 + 64x^2 - 16x -16x + 4

= 9x^2 + 64x^2 -12x - 12x -16x - 16x + 16 + 4

= 73x^2 - 56x + 20
